Panthera : Death Spiral.    Chapter One - continued

  The cubs' blood samples showed they'd made thousands of antibodies. She asked the computer to identify the ones for Nereva, and came up with a blank.  "It could have been that," she said, and showed him the analyses.  "Show me the scan files."
  Cory obliged, and she homed in on the thymus glands of the cats.  "What the hell?  Check this out for me.  What do you think of this?"
  "I'd say all three glands look shrunken.  I don't think that can be the result of genetics."
    Ren nodded.  "I agree.  I've never seen a defect like this before."  She grimaced.  "Sorry, Cory, but we need better scans of their thymus glands.  You're going to have to pull them out of cryo."
  
  An hour later she and Cory sat down to look at the new scans. "Here goes," he said as he opened the first file.  "Huh!  It's massively atrophied.  He opened the other two files.  They were the same.
  "Zoom in there," Ren said, pointing her finger at a region of the gland on the boundary of the cortex and medulla.  Cory obliged and she studied the images.  "The boundary between the two sections is wrong.  There's a bunch of dead cells there, but it doesn't look like a tumour."  She traced a curved line on the screen.  "This looks like a scrape mark, as if someone's put in a pipette and removed cells.  I think whatever they did has damaged this region."
  "Why would anyone take those cells?" Cory asked.
  "I don't know.  But I do know these aren't natural deaths.  Someone's take away so much of their thymus glands they can't make new antibodies.  These cubs have been murdered."
